Existential therapy believes that although humans are essentially alone in the world, they long to be connected with themselves and others. I seek to avoid using models that may label people. Truth is discovered subjectively, by each individual. My practice is often, directly aimed at collaboratively making sense of one's experience(s) in order to forge new meanings and develop new identities. From a strengths based perspective, I collaborate with my clients to increase self-awareness and understanding in order to transform fragile or confusing relationships into ones that can be more clear, strong and connected.This includes a specialty in working with couples.
I believe that relationships are the roots of our subjective "success". My specialty is accompanying clients into self-discovery sessions that reveal to them how transforming their relationships can directly and concretely support their goals.
My additional training and practice as a Certified Life Coach has allowed me to support my clients by developing a practice that synthesizes talk therapy into the mindful actions of daily life. This kind of support can help clients make headway beyond our one-on-one sessions in the office.
